    Since 1983, he has been working in various positions at the former Szombathely Teacher Training College, employed by the Department of Technology, initially as a laboratory assistant and technical administrator, then as an assistant teacher, assistant professor and associate professor. His duties include compiling the equipment of the electronics and IT laboratories, making experimental equipment, operating computers, implementing controls with microcomputers and integrating all of these into education. He began his higher education activity as a lecturer with the subject Introduction to Computer Science, and then continued with foundational subjects related to IT.
    In 1998, he became a full-time lecturer at the then newly named Berzsenyi Dániel Teacher Training College (BDTF), then at its legal successor, the University of West Hungary (NyME), and later - after the separation of the Savaria University Center (SEK) from NyME - at the Faculty of Informatics of the Eötvös Loránd University Savaria University Center (ELTE SEK) (from 2017). In 2019, he participated in the development of the EDLRIS (European Driving License for Robots and Intelligent Systems) project (a unified, standardized, internationally recognized training and certification system in the field of robotics and artificial intelligence). For several years, he has led robotics circles and summer camps; since 2018, he has been organizing robotics competitions related to student age groups in Szombathely; from 2023, he is one of the founders of the Szombathely Robotics Club. Since the 2020s, it has been working on topics related to industrial and engineering history, as well as developing methodological and professional programs necessary for teaching the subject of technology.

    Active member of several professional organizations (National Association of Technology Teachers; Regional Non-Profit Association for Technical Culture; Hungarian Academy of Sciences (MTA) Complex Committee on the History of Science and Technology; Member of the Hungarian Academy of Sciences Public Body; Szombathely Scientific Society; Editorial Board of the Journal of Mechanical Engineering; Vas County Regional Organization of the John Neumann Computer Science Society (NJSZT); Association for Technical and Natural Science Culture).
    Awards: Minister of Culture Commendation (1987); President-Vice-Rector Commendation (NyME, 2009); Commemorative Medal on the occasion of the 50th anniversary of higher education in Szombathely (NyME, 2010); Commemorative Plaque for Technical Education (NyME, 2012); Neumann Prize (NJSZT, 2023); Certificate of Recognition for Teacher Training (ELTE, 2023).
